Teo Rodriguez
Manage episode 324547935 series 3097823
In this episode Mr. Teo Rodriguez discusses what life was like in his home country of El Salvador. When Rodriguez first arrived in The United States his first job was as a dish washer. He is now the general manager at the popular Mexican restaurant El Toro in Robbinsdale, MN.
4 tập